Optimizing images for swift loading
Optimizing images is often an overlooked, but crucial aspect of website optimization, as they can significantly impact website speed.
To ensure swift loading, it’s crucial to use the right image formats. Generally, JPEG is the preferred format for photographs, while PNG is better suited for images with text or transparent backgrounds.
Additionally, you should compress your images without compromising visual quality. Various online tools and software can help you do this.
Implementing responsive images is another effective way to optimize images for different devices and screen sizes. This ensures that your website loads quickly on all devices, providing a consistent user experience.
Lazy loading is also a technique you should consider, as it delays the loading of images until they are needed. This can significantly improve the perceived performance of your website, especially on pages with a lot of images.
Lastly, consider using the WebP format for your images. WebP is a modern image format that offers superior compression without compromising visual quality.
It is supported by most modern browsers and can significantly reduce image file sizes, resulting in faster loading times.
Leveraging browser caching techniques
is another effective strategy for enhancing website performance. Browser caching allows the browser to store static assets such as images, CSS files, and JavaScript files locally on the user’s device.
When a user visits your website for the first time, these assets are downloaded and stored in the browser’s cache.
On subsequent visits, the browser can retrieve these assets from the local cache rather than downloading them again, significantly reducing the time it takes to load the website.
To enable browser caching for static assets, you can set appropriate HTTP headers in your server response. The HTTP Expires header specifies the date and time after which the cached asset should be considered expired and re-downloaded from the server.
The HTTP Cache-Control header provides more granular control over caching behavior, allowing you to specify how long the asset should be cached and under what conditions it can be cached.
Additionally, you can use ETags and Last-Modified headers to enable conditional requests. With ETags, the server generates a unique identifier for each asset.
When a user requests an asset, the browser sends the ETag along with the request. The server then compares the ETag with the current version of the asset.
If they match, the server sends a 304 Not Modified status code, indicating that the cached asset is still valid and does not need to be re-downloaded.
Last-Modified headers work similarly. The server sends the date and time of the last modification of the asset. The browser compares this timestamp with the cached version of the asset.
If the cached asset is older than the last modification date, the browser sends a request for the updated asset. Otherwise, it uses the cached version.
By implementing these browser caching techniques, you can reduce server load, improve website responsiveness, and provide a better overall user experience.
Implementing content delivery networks (CDNs)
Content delivery networks (CDNs) play a crucial role in enhancing website performance and ensuring a seamless user experience.
A CDN is a geographically distributed network of servers that stores cached copies of your website’s static content, such as images, CSS files, and JavaScript files.
This allows users to access your website’s content from the nearest server location, reducing latency and improving load times.
Selecting the right CDN provider is essential for optimizing the benefits of a CDN. Consider factors such as the provider’s network coverage, pricing plans, security features, and customer support. Some popular CDN providers include Amazon CloudFront, Cloudflare, and Akamai.
Once you have chosen a CDN provider, you need to configure and integrate the CDN with your website’s infrastructure.
This typically involves updating your website’s DNS records to point to the CDN’s servers and making changes to your website’s code to reference the CDN’s URLs for static content.
Monitoring and analyzing CDN performance is crucial to ensure that your website is delivering optimal performance. Most CDN providers offer detailed analytics and reporting tools that provide insights into traffic patterns, server load, and content delivery times.
Regularly monitoring these metrics allows you to identify any performance issues and make necessary adjustments to your CDN configuration.
By implementing a CDN, you can effectively distribute your website’s content, reduce load times, and enhance the overall user experience. This can lead to improved search engine rankings, increased website traffic, and higher conversion rates.
